Spatio-temporal patterns and landscape-associated risk of Buruli ulcer in Akonolinga, Cameroon.

BACKGROUND:Buruli ulcer (BU) is an extensively damaging skin infection caused by Mycobacterium ulcerans, whose transmission mode is still unknown.
